At its core, checking for a warrant involves accessing public record databases that are maintained by courts and law enforcement agencies. 8.Stop Guessing: Find Out If You Have a Warrant and What to Do Next for Free typically guides users through a series of straightforward steps, such as entering their name and location into a secure search interface. These platforms draw from county and state databases, where arrest and court records are often a matter of public record. While the technology varies by provider, the general process is designed to be simple enough for someone with no legal background to navigate confidently. It is important to note that these tools offer informational snapshots, not legal advice, and they work best when users understand both their scope and their limits.
Behind the scenes, these systems rely on data normalization and keyword matching to locate relevant entries. For example, a person named βJordan Leeβ might input their middle initial or date of birth to narrow results and avoid confusion with others who share a similar name. Courts may update records on different schedules, so timeliness can vary. Some services also provide educational content, explaining what a bench warrant, an arrest warrant, or a child support warrant typically means in practical terms. Many people wonder how accurate these free warrant checks really are. Because public databases can contain outdated or incomplete entries, results should be treated as a starting point for further action rather than a final verdict. A search through 8.Stop Guessing: Find Out If You Have a Warrant and What to Do Next for Free might show no active records, which generally indicates that there are no publicly listed warrants in the searched jurisdictions. However, some local courts may not be fully digitized or may experience reporting delays, so the absence of a record does not guarantee that none exist. Users who receive unclear or unexpected results are encouraged to contact the relevant court directly for confirmation.
Another frequent question is whether using these services carries any legal risk. In most cases, simply checking public records is lawful and protected as part of informed citizenship. Because the process does not involve hacking, impersonation, or accessing private databases, it operates within standard legal boundaries. Still, individuals who discover an active warrant should avoid taking matters into their own hands. Instead, consulting with a qualified legal professional becomes an important next step. At the same time, responsible use requires realistic expectations. Free warrant checks typically cover publicly available information, but they may not reflect sealed records, expunged cases, or recently filed charges that have not yet entered public databases. Relying solely on a quick online search without professional legal advice can leave important details unexamined. Users should also be cautious about providing sensitive information to unfamiliar platforms. Choosing services with clear privacy policies and transparent data practices helps reduce risk. Things People Often Misunderstand
A common myth is that any mention of a warrant means immediate arrest, but this is not always the case. Many warrants stem from missed court appearances for minor violations and may have been issued long before a search is conducted. Law enforcement priorities and resource constraints mean that not every warrant results in active enforcement. Another misunderstanding is that these online checks can replace legal counsel. While they are useful for initial awareness, they cannot interpret complex jurisdictional rules or individual circumstances. 8.Stop Guessing: Find Out If You Have a Warrant and What to Do Next for Free is best used as an educational tool, not a substitute for professional advice.
People also sometimes assume that if a search returns no results, their legal record is completely clean. In reality, database coverage varies by jurisdiction, and some courts update their records infrequently. Misinterpretation of dates, names, or case numbers can lead to unnecessary worry or false confidence. Clarifying these points helps users develop a balanced perspective.
